Abstract

1,056,369. Drilling. ATLAS COPCO A.B. Oct. 12, 1965 [Oct. 14, 1964], No. 43208/65. Heading B3C. [Also in Division B4] An automatic rotary-percussive rock drilling machine comprises a rock drill 10 mounted on a slide 11 which is movable forward and backwards along a shell 12 by means of a reversible feed motor 18, a limit switch 71 being mounted on the forward end of the shell so that when operated by the rock drill a reversing valve 60 is actuated via a circuit 70, 77, 78 and servomotor 60a thereby causing the rock drill to return to its rearward position. The reversible motor is compressed-air operated and connected via feed lines 54, 55 to a control valve 51 communicating with a main feed line 39 which is connected via a diaphragm actuated valve 32 with the pressure source. A second control valve 40 is connected via a passage 36 and a line 42 with the rock drill. A third control valve 44 is provided for controlling flushing water through a line 48, a servo-operated valve 50, line 49 and a bore 22 in the drill bit 15. In operation, with the rock-drill in its rearward position so that an abutment 76 on the slide is actuating a rear limit-switch 72, a manually-actuated valve 87 is operated so as to admit air to open the diaphragm-controlled valve 31 thereby allowing the air to flow via the valves 40 and 51 to actuate the rock-drill and the feed motor respectively, water is also fed to the drill bit via valves 44, 50. The slide then moves forward on its drilling stroke allowing the rear limit switch to move to its alternative position and thereby, via lines 85, 89, maintain the diaphragm valve open. At the completion of the drilling stroke, the forward limit switch 71 is operated which then, via the servo-circuit 70, 77, 78 actuates the reversing valve so that the feed motor reverses the drill slide. Simultaneously, the air for operating the rock drill is throttled via a plunger 80 in the valve 40 and the reversal of the pressure to the feed motor causes actuation of a second servo-circuit 81, 84 so that the delivery of flushing water is replaced by flushing air via a conduit 47. The rock drill returns to its rear position thereby actuating the rear limit switch so that the air to the diaphragm valve is exhausted and so allows the latter to close. In a modification, Fig. 11 (not shown) the rear limit switch is dispensed with and replaced by a shuttle valve 105 for controlling the reversing valve 60 and the throttle plunger 80. A further valve 100 is provided for controlling air fed to a motor 104 for rotating the drill bit. The pneumatic controlling circuits may be replaced by hydraulic or electric circuits.
